A Phosphothreonine Residue at the C-Terminal End of the Plasma Membrane H(+)-ATPase Is Protected by Fusicoccin-Induced 14–3–3 Binding
We have isolated the plasma membrane H(+)−ATPase in a phosphorylated form from spinach (Spinacia oleracea L.) leaf tissue incubated with fusicoccin, a fungal toxin that induces irreversible binding of 14–3–3 protein to the C terminus of the H(+)-ATPase, thus activating H(+) pumping.
